Build Provenance: Image Slimming Pipeline

Support team: every slimmed container produced by the Thornpack pipeline carries provenance metadata recording the base image digest, the layers removed, and the attestation of the slimming step. When a customer reports a missing binary, first confirm which slimmed variant they run. Each variant is identified by the build token recorded below.

pipeline stamp: htk9_ce63042d9

Quarterly Planning Note – Larchmont Devices

Hi branch managers — the reseller programme kicks off properly next quarter. We're onboarding eight partners across the Velden region, with tiered margins and a shared demo-stock pool. Please nominate one contact per branch to handle partner queries, and keep lead registration tidy so commissions don't get messy. Training packs land mid-month. There's one strategic point we're keeping close, appended below.

board note of yadup-fajef: Druiusox Holdings is in early talks to buy Norwynek Systems for about $186.0 million. The Kaseth launch date is June 24, and nothing goes to the press before then. Legal wants the Quenethek Group term sheet withdrawn before November 27.

## CrashFunnel Environments

CrashFunnel is the pipeline that collects crash reports from the Lumepad mobile apps. There are two environments: sandbox (for QA builds) and live. Sandbox keeps reports for 7 days only, so don't panic if old test crashes vanish. Live feeds the dashboards the support team uses daily. The live environment runs with the following configuration.

deployment values, kajep-kageg:
[praix]
host = praix.paliqcorp.corp
user = praix_svc
database = praix_prod

## Artifact Signing — Renderfleet Transcode Farm

Every transcoder build must be signed before it hits the farm scheduler. Unsigned artifacts are rejected at intake. Build the image, run `fleetctl sign`, then push to the Renderfleet registry. CI signs nightly builds automatically; manual hotfixes need a local signature. Verify with `fleetctl verify` before promoting to the Osterby cluster. The current signing key for manual builds is below.

rollout seal: bky4_x7Gc